Fort Worth and Western Railroad Company--Acquisition Exemption--
Line of The Atchison, Topeka and Santa Fe Railway Company
Fort Worth and Western Railroad Company (FWWR), a Class III rail
carrier, has filed a notice of exemption under 49 CFR 1150.41 to
acquire a rail line of The Atchison, Topeka and Santa Fe Railway
Company extending from Milepost 0.82, at Belt Junction, to Milepost
1.29, a distance of approximately 0.47 miles, in the City of Fort
Worth, Tarrant County, TX. FWWR will operate the property.

\1\ The ICC Termination Act of 1995, Pub. L. 104-88, 109 Stat.
803, which was enacted on December 29, 1995, and took effect on
January 1, 1996, abolished the Interstate Commerce Commission and
transferred certain functions to the Surface Transportation Board
(Board). This notice relates to functions that are subject to Board
jurisdiction pursuant to 49 U.S.C. 10902.

The transaction was scheduled to be consummated on or after July
31, 1996.
If the notice contains false or misleading information, the
exemption is void ab initio. Petitions to revoke the exemption under 49
U.S.C. 10502(d) may be filed at any time. The filing of a petition to
revoke does not automatically stay the transaction.
